By the time Version 10 Professional was released, the software had developed a dedicated user base due to its relatively low system requirements, intuitive interface, and powerful automation tools. In late 2001, Corel Corporation acquired Micrografx, gradually integrating its technology into Corel’s own software suite and marking the end of standalone Picture Publisher updates.
